What is the Australian Qualifications Framework (AQF)?

The Australian Qualifications Framework acts as the national policy regarding regulated qualifications throughout Australian education and training. Integrating qualifications from the various education and training domains into a single comprehensive framework, encompassing schools, vocational education and training (VET), and tertiary education.

AQF Levels Relevant to RTOs

Comprising ten levels, the AQF ten levels, defining various complexities and depths of educational outcomes. This guide focuses on the AQF levels most pertinent to RTOs and vocational training programmes, specifically levels 1 to 6.

Certificate I: AQF Level 1

- Introduction: Certificate I is the entry-level qualification which offers foundational functional knowledge and skills necessary for initial work, contributing to community involvement, or further learning.
- Expertise and Knowledge: Basic knowledge and skills for routine tasks. Basic operational skills with the capability to deploy them in a specific context.
- Implementation: Suitable for entry-level positions and positions needing basic skills. Typically serves as a foundation for further learning and learning.

Introduction to AQF Level 2: Certificate II

- Summary: Certificate II develops further on the skills and knowledge offered by Certificate I, delivering more sophisticated skills fit for various vocational roles.
- Capabilities and Knowledge: A broader range of skills for particular tasks. Capability to execute routine tasks and solve anticipated problems.
- Application: Ideal for positions needing basic operational knowledge and capabilities. Serves as a stepping stone for further learning and initial job positions.

Certificate III: AQF Level 3

- Overview: Offering more advanced technical and theoretical knowledge, Certificate III provides with skills suitable for skilled jobs and further learning.

Expertise and Proficiency: Significant insight into specific domains and the ability to apply it. Skills for performing a range of complicated responsibilities and resolving unforeseen issues. Suitable for practical application: Well-suited for technical work and trades. Frequently necessary for trainee and apprenticeship programmes.

Level 4 AQF: Four Certificate

Brief Overview: Certificate Four delivers more specialised knowledge and skills for higher-level roles and further education. Talent and Know-How: Detailed theoretical and applied expertise in a specific domain. Talents for directing and supervising personnel, and managing operations. Appropriate for use: Designed for supervisory and technical work. Setting the groundwork for higher academic or focussed vocational training.

Level 5 AQF: Diploma

Overview: Diploma credentials supply upper-tier theoretical and applied knowledge and competencies for professional tasks and extended learning. Competencies and Insight: General proficiency and ability for paraprofessional and technical positions. Proficiency in analysing and using knowledge in different frameworks. Usage: Fitting for managerial and technical professions. Often a prerequisite for further higher education.

Level Six AQF: Advanced Diploma, Associate Degree

Outline: Credentials for Advanced Diploma and Associate Degree deliver elevated theoretical and hands-on proficiency. Competencies and Insight: Elevated understanding and abilities in sophisticated technical and theoretical situations. Prepares for professional fields or further undergraduate learning. Practical Usage: Ideal for elevated technical, support, and managerial positions. Often used for credit transfer into bachelor degree programmes.

Necessity of AQF Compliance for Registered Training Organisations

Quality Standards and Accreditation

Upholding Standards: AQF adherence secures that qualifications offered by RTOs align with national education and training benchmarks.

Validation: Compliance is critical for RTOs to gain and maintain accreditation from regulatory bodies such as ASQA (Australian Skills Quality Authority).

Learning Pathways

- Straightforward Shifts: The AQF helps in making transitions between different education sectors. facilitating learners to move forward through their educational and career routes.
- Recognition of Previous Experience: The framework supports the recognition of prior learning. enabling learners to receive credit from earlier learning and work.
